Hola a todos,
Me he lanzado a instalar un servidor nuevo en el aula IBM con TCOS, para reutilizar los viejos IBM, siguiendo los pasos del manual de Ezequiel casi logro el éxito, consigo crear la imagen, arranco los clientes IBM, me conecta con el servidor, pero los ordenadores IBM no son capaces de cargar las X.
Deduzco que mi servidor tiene una gráfica diferente a los IBM, ¿puede ser el fallo por eso?
¿Alguien me da una pista por donde seguir?
Muchas gracias,
Error Xorg en TCOS aula IBM
Moderadores: daniel.esteban, victor.armendariz, ruben.garcia45, irene.olalla, dgonzalezarroyo
-
- Mensajes: 581
- Registrado: 05 Ene 2008, 21:00
- Contactar:
La tarjeta gráfica del servidor sólo se usa para la sesión que arranques en el servidor, si los clientes no cargan entorno gráfico deberás investigar el motivo en los clientes no en el servidor...
-
- Mensajes: 1365
- Registrado: 03 Mar 2005, 14:02
Hola.
No estoy en el centro todavía y no te puedo reproducir la situación pero...
... la gráfica intel i8xx de la placa base de los IBM sieeemmmpre han dado problemas de driver fuera del entorno original...
Existen soluciones que propuso ya hace bastante tiempo Mario que es el creador de TCOS. Desgraciadamente todo ello pasaba por usar los drivers intel para Ubuntu Lucid desarrollados por Stefan Glasenhardt. Se trataba de instalar un ppa en el sources.list del servidor y de ahí instalar con apt-get o synaptic los drivers intel. El método recomendado es en la terminal ejecutar:
Además hay que editar como root /etc/tcos/pxelinux.cfg.tpl y al final del primer grupo de arranque donde pone:
añadir: "vga=791"
Con esto los terminales cargan el driver genérico VESA en "framebuffer" a 1024x768 que es muuuuuy estándar. Se pierde la posible aceleración gráfica pero es que no se suele usar con los alumnos.
Problema... esos drivers se han actualizado y funcionan con una opción del kernel que creo que no funciona en los IBM. Prueba pero me temo que no funcionen.
Se pueden buscar los antiguos e instalar a mano en un servidor de 32 bits usando la orden dpkg. Si es un servidor de 64 bits hay que currarselo aún mas. Los drivers "viejos" con los que funcionaba y hay que instalar son:
libdrm2_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-intel1_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-nouveau1_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-radeon1_2.4.25~glasen~lucid~ppa1_i386.deb
xserver-xorg-video-intel_2.15.0~lucid~ppa4_i386.deb
Se pueden obtener de:
https://launchpad.net/~glasen/+archive/ ... ld/2405668
https://launchpad.net/~glasen/+archive/ ... ld/2513414
Descargalos por ejemplo en /home/madrid/IBM
En el caso de los 64 bits hay que copiar los deb en el chroot de TCOS:
He instalarlos con:
Una vez hecho esto se vuelve a generar las imágenes de arranque sin cambiar configuraciones desde TcosConfig.
Cuando vuelva al insti y tenga tiempo te busco más opciones. Yo tengo instalado MAX 6.5 directamente en los IBM con el driver genérico Intel "fbdev" que es una versión específica de framebuffer.
¡Suerte!
No estoy en el centro todavía y no te puedo reproducir la situación pero...
... la gráfica intel i8xx de la placa base de los IBM sieeemmmpre han dado problemas de driver fuera del entorno original...

Existen soluciones que propuso ya hace bastante tiempo Mario que es el creador de TCOS. Desgraciadamente todo ello pasaba por usar los drivers intel para Ubuntu Lucid desarrollados por Stefan Glasenhardt. Se trataba de instalar un ppa en el sources.list del servidor y de ahí instalar con apt-get o synaptic los drivers intel. El método recomendado es en la terminal ejecutar:
Código: Seleccionar todo
sudo add-apt-repository ppa:glasen/intel-drive
Código: Seleccionar todo
boot=tcos quiet
Con esto los terminales cargan el driver genérico VESA en "framebuffer" a 1024x768 que es muuuuuy estándar. Se pierde la posible aceleración gráfica pero es que no se suele usar con los alumnos.
Problema... esos drivers se han actualizado y funcionan con una opción del kernel que creo que no funciona en los IBM. Prueba pero me temo que no funcionen.
Se pueden buscar los antiguos e instalar a mano en un servidor de 32 bits usando la orden dpkg. Si es un servidor de 64 bits hay que currarselo aún mas. Los drivers "viejos" con los que funcionaba y hay que instalar son:
libdrm2_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-intel1_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-nouveau1_2.4.25~glasen~lucid~ppa1_i386.deb
libdrm-radeon1_2.4.25~glasen~lucid~ppa1_i386.deb
xserver-xorg-video-intel_2.15.0~lucid~ppa4_i386.deb
Se pueden obtener de:
https://launchpad.net/~glasen/+archive/ ... ld/2405668
https://launchpad.net/~glasen/+archive/ ... ld/2513414
Descargalos por ejemplo en /home/madrid/IBM
En el caso de los 64 bits hay que copiar los deb en el chroot de TCOS:
Código: Seleccionar todo
sudo cp /home/madrid/IBM/*deb /var/lib/tcos/chroot/
Código: Seleccionar todo
sudo chroot /var/lib/tcos/chroot/ dpkg -i /*deb
Cuando vuelva al insti y tenga tiempo te busco más opciones. Yo tengo instalado MAX 6.5 directamente en los IBM con el driver genérico Intel "fbdev" que es una versión específica de framebuffer.
¡Suerte!
¡¡¡Se libre!!!
¡¡¡Usa MAX!!!
¡¡¡Usa MAX!!!
-
- Mensajes: 1365
- Registrado: 03 Mar 2005, 14:02
Hola de nuevo.
Antes de hacer nada de nada de todo el post anterior prueba 1.º a:
- Con Tcos-config escoge en Opciones de Xorg > Driver de video por defecto > VESA
luego haz la imagen y comprueba.
Si eso no funciona entonces entra en terminal y:
- Edita como root /etc/tcos/pxelinux.cfg.tpl y en la primera línea que veas que pone:
boot=tcos quiet
añade
Si cualquiera de estas dos acciones resuelve el problema, por favor indicalo en el foro.
¡Suerte!
Antes de hacer nada de nada de todo el post anterior prueba 1.º a:
- Con Tcos-config escoge en Opciones de Xorg > Driver de video por defecto > VESA
luego haz la imagen y comprueba.
Si eso no funciona entonces entra en terminal y:
- Edita como root /etc/tcos/pxelinux.cfg.tpl y en la primera línea que veas que pone:
boot=tcos quiet
añade
Código: Seleccionar todo
boot=tcos quiet xmodule=fbdev
¡Suerte!
¡¡¡Se libre!!!
¡¡¡Usa MAX!!!
¡¡¡Usa MAX!!!
-
- Mensajes: 10
- Registrado: 12 Feb 2012, 14:05
Al final solucioné este problema seleccionado la "Autodetección de las xorg", con los drivers antiguos instalados y seleccionando VESA, habían algunos equipos en la que la máxima resolución de pantalla era 600 x 460, y no dejaba cambiarla.